Anil Kshetarpal, J.

1.

The petitioner herein is a landlord. He has filed the petition under Section 13-B of the East Punjab Urban Rent Restriction Act, 1949. The case is at the initial stage. His application for permission to correct the caption of the petition has been dismissed.

2.

In substance, the petitioner claims that he should have filed a petition under the Punjab Rent Act, 1995, which has superseded the previous Act, namely the East Punjab Urban Rent Restriction Act, 1949. The Rent Controller has dismissed the application.

3.

The petitioner claims eviction of the respondents on the ground of bonafide necessity as he is a Non-Resident Indian. The aforesaid ground is also available under the 1995 Act.

4.
